Real-time recording system for Brainstem auditory evoked responses and the study of stimulus polarity effects

Abstract
In this paper, a real time recording system for the Brainstem Auditory Evoked Response (BAER), designed and developed is evaluated by testing the known effects of click polarity on interpeak latencies (IPL) of BAER in normals and in patients with suspected Brainstem Ischaemia. The click polarity affects IPLs. The Rarefaction click generates the clearest waveform which would be most useful in clinical diagnosis.
